As an electrician, you'll also be expected to follow safety standards and regulations set by the industry. It is crucial to get various certifications to ensure you are competent and safe in the job you do.

You might be required to possess a Level 3 qualification for testing and inspection. This permits you to determine whether an electrical installation is safe, and also if it complies with UK wiring regulations (BS7671).

A Level 3 electrician can also earn a variety of other certifications, including electrical installation and specialized courses focusing on custom-designed projects, such as electric vehicle charging points. Insurance

The work of electrical equipment is dangerous, so it's important for electricians to have the right insurance to protect themselves and their work. If  local electricians Buckinghamshire  do not have adequate insurance you could be liable for damages and lost time while on the job.

Electricians are often covered by public liability insurance, which protects them in the event of injury to other people or damage to property as a result of their work. It also covers legal fees and compensation if they are sued for negligence.

Consider purchasing product liability insurance to protect your company and clients from the risk of damaged or defective wires or electrical equipment that you import, supply or install, or repair. This is especially beneficial for domestic use, since it protects consumers.

You're likely to be an entrepreneur on the move as sparkie. Therefore it is essential that you have an insurance plan for your vehicle or ute in the event of an accident. There is a chance that you will be liable for thousands of dollars worth of repair costs if you don't have it.

As a legal requirement, you must also carry employer's insurance. This insurance is able to compensate your employees suffer injuries or become ill, or if you lose their wages because of an accident.

If you don't have this insurance, you could be facing a penalty of up to PS2,500 per day as an employee. It is important to carry insurance for professional indemnity since it will safeguard you from claims brought against you by your clients for damages to their property or the design of their new extension.
